Black Mountain Bowmen is a free outdoor range that offers not only target practice at various distances but also an "archery course" (similar to a golf course) where you shoot at various targets situated in different parts of the range. I've been going here occasionally when I want to shoot outdoors (as opposed to an indoor range) and it's great to have the option to practice at farther distances. Indoor ranges are a bit limited in the sense of what distances are possible to practice with. One thing that you'll find at this range is that there are a lot of compound shooters who will be practicing at the longest ranges--that's only natural. One feedback I do have for the range is that the targets could be replaced more often. Note the photo I've added here--it was a bit difficult to practice precision since the inner circle was completely gone. All that said, I see myself coming back here in the future!

This place has been my primary location for shooting archery over the years and the vibe has always been amazing. This location has a large target range for those who enjoy shooting in the same lane; as well as a 28 target course along a trail (similar to shooting golf). The targets are frequently replaced and they grass is always cut making it easier to locate and retrieve stray arrows. I'd recommend this place to any aspiring archers!

It's hard to find a place to shoot some arrows while letting my hair fly through the wind but this is the place. My friend frequents here often and so he took me here once and it was great. There isn't any fee and you just have to bring your own equipment. Other archers here are super friendly and love to talk about archery events with you. Pleasant experience and worth the drive.

James R.

This archery range is so tucked away that I bet you didn't even know it was there. When you arrive, there is a full practice range with ten targets ranging from twenty to seventy feet away. Paper targets are on the hay bales, but I suggest bringing your own, as these are sometimes chewed up. Beyond the range there is a trail with a large number of shooting areas, all at different distances. It is a nice trail that is not overly strenuous. Just remember, hunting is NOT allowed, even though you will see lots of wildlife...

What is the shortest distance available on the range?

For beginners, several 10 yard targets, and some seemingly closer.

How much is the lesson?

This is a club and public range. They periodically will not be open to the public for events. They don't rent equipment or have lessons. You would need to arrange that privately and bring the equipment and instructor with you. I'd recommend just… 

Are crossbows welcome here?

Santa Clara County Park Range Rules Cross-bows are prohibited.
